Accident Dornier Do17Z-3 7T+CH,

Date:Friday 4 October 1940
Time:
Type:Dornier Do17Z-3
Owner/operator:1./Kü.Fl.Gr.?? Luftwaffe
Registration: 7T+CH
MSN: 3617
Fatalities:Fatalities: 4 / Occupants: 4
Aircraft damage: Destroyed
Location:sea off Caen-Carpiquet -   France
Phase: Combat
Nature:Military

Narrative:
Shot down by flak during attack on Penrhos airfield and crashed into the sea. All four crew members are MIA.
